Ibrahim Ali Khan and Khushi Kapoor are poised to portray a romantic relationship in Karan Johar's forthcoming romantic drama, Nadaaniyan. Following the release of the initial song, Ishq Mein, the production team has unveiled another track from the film, which depicts the couple grappling with heartbreak.

Nadaaniyan's song Galat Fehmi

On Monday, Sony Music India released the poignant song Galat Fehmi from Nadaaniyan on social media platforms. The accompanying video features Ibrahim and Khushi in tears, struggling with trust issues as they navigate their emotional turmoil. The visuals depict them avoiding one another while dealing with their heartache. Nevertheless, the video concludes with the pair reconciling and sharing a tender moment.

The music video’s caption stated, “For the ones who loved, lost, and never got to explain! #GalatFehmi song out now.” The track is composed by Sachin-Jigar, with lyrics by Amitabh Bhattacharya, and performed by Tushar Joshi, Madhubanti Bagchi, and Sachin-Jigar. It encapsulates the sentiment that misunderstandings often arise when trust is compromised in a relationship.

About Nadaaniyan

This film marks Ibrahim’s debut in Bollywood. Nadaaniyan offers a contemporary perspective on romance, emphasizing how digital interactions complicate young love. According to Netflix’s synopsis, “A South Delhi diva, a middle-class overachiever boy, and one outrageous plan: hire him as her fake boyfriend to save her squad. But when real feelings crash their party, can they handle the mess of falling in love?”

Supported by Karan Johar, Apoorva Mehta, and Somen Misra through Dharmatic Entertainment, the film features prominent performances by Mahima Chaudhary, Suniel Shetty, Dia Mirza, and Jugal Hansraj. It is set to be available for streaming on Netflix, although the specific release date has not yet been disclosed.
